Elsenham Station boasts a range of ticketing facilities to facilitate a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:00 to 13:30 from Monday to Saturday, ensuring you can get tickets or resolve queries in person. Although not operational on Sundays, you’ll find ticket machines on-site for round-the-clock service,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ets at your convenience.
The station has suitably accessible infrastructure. With step-free access available between platforms via Old Mead Road, travellers with mobility needs are well-catered for. There's also an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, making the station user-friendly for all.
While Elsenham may lack some facilities like luggage storage and toilets, it compensates with its service offerings in other areas. Refreshments can be found by the entrance to Platform 2, ensuring you stay nourished on your travels. Public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ected, and sheltered bicycle storage caters to cyclists, providing stands on each platform.
Safety is assured as the station is equipped with CCTV, and help points are strategically located to assist travellers as needed. While there aren't any launch facilities or 1st Class lounges, waiting rooms with seating areas are available, offering a comfortable spot to rest between journeys.
Getting to and from Elsenham Station is made easy with various transport links. While there are no accessible taxis or dedicated set-down points, local bus services integrate seamlessly with the train schedules. For those unexpected schedule changes, rail replacement services can be accessed at the nearby Station Road and New Road bus stop.

While Belmont Train Station doesn’t boast a physical ticket office, fear not, as ticket machines are available for you to purchase and collect tickets with ease. These machines provide accessibility for all passengers, including those who benefit from a Disabled Persons Railcard discount. It’s worth noting that staff assistance is readily available via help points for any queries or assistance you might require during your visit.
In terms of accessibility, Belmont Station truly shines. It is classified as a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out the premises. This ensures that everyone, regardless of mobility levels, can navigate the station with ease. Help points are situated on platforms, providing immediate assistance via an “emergency & assisted travel” button.
For those looking to cycle, the station offers sheltered bicycle storage spaces equipped with CCTV for added security, making it a breeze to transition from bike to train. However, do keep in mind that services like refreshment facilities, waiting rooms, and ATMs are currently unavailable, so plan ahead to optimize your visit.
Belmont Station not only makes travel convenient within the rail network but also provides access to various other modes of transportation. Bus services are clustered around, enhancing connectivity and ensuring smooth onward travel. Information to assist in planning your further journey is accessible through an onward travel information map available at the station.
In situations where rail services are disrupted, rail replacement services operate, ensuring that your journey remains uninterrupted. Make sure to check the detailed information regarding their locations at the station to avoid any last-minute surprises.
